A dear friend of mine was in town and staying in Redondo. She didn't have a car, so I made the trek to see her. Cal Mex was the place. A charming little spot right on the beach. A delightful gentleman greeted me and escorted us to a table with a relaxing view of the ocean. Lily was our server, and she was lovely. We started with cocktails - a Watermelon Margarita for me and Cucumber Jalapeño for my friend. Each was refreshing and tasty. We shared the Spicy Cauliflower & Veggie Empanadas. Both dishes were flavorful and exceptionally good. The Spicy Cauliflower was on a bed of sweet potato puree & quinoa and topped with crispy potato threads. It wasn't very spicy, but it was tasty. The pastry of the Veggie Empanadas was crispy. Inside was a delicious mixture of mushroom-adobado & a gruyere cheese blend. We also enjoyed the complimentary chips & salsa. It was a nice, relaxing evening and we had a wonderful time catching up. Even though I'm not a fan of long drives. I'd come back here. Parking was easy & convenient because the lot is nearby. $2 per hour.

Service was really great. We were seated promptly and drinks came out fast. The Cadillac margarita was generously sized. My husband had the watermelon margarita. Both were buzz worthy. My husband had the Cal Mex burger which came with waffle cut French fries. Tasty but didn't look so great on the plate. I had the pulpo borracho which came in a spicy chipotle type heavy red sauce with potatoes and pineapple. I thought the heavy sauce overpowered the few pieces of octopus which were cooked really well. We also had the Brussels and pork belly that were ok. They were a little too tangy but the Brussels and the pork belly were cooked well. We would try it again for the ambiance which was so nice and the service which was fast and friendly.

I came to the Redondo Pier and noticed the sign for Cal Mex Cantina and decided to venture for their happy hour. It was Tuesday so they also have as part of their offering, tacos for Taco Tuesday. I tried their Vampira taco which was very delicious- a slow cooked beef and a blanco cheese that was pressed into the tortilla. It was about an 8inch tortilla, not that big but substantial. 1 taco $8. They also offered a limited draft beer menu along with some cocktails. Since it was mid afternoon, it was not busy and the bartender/wait staff person was very cordial and helpful. The decor is very nice and the view overlooking Redondo Beach is beautiful. From what I understand, they allow dogs on their outdoor patio. I'll be coming back with our pup!

Do you have gluten free items?

Anything made with corn flour is gluten free. Try some tacos

What is the happy hour like?

You can make an entire meal out of the food options and there are several inexpensive (yet tasty) margarita, beer and wine options. 5 out of 5

Does this place have a full bar?

Yes it did. Food and service was also really good.

Are the habanero beans made with lard?

We do not use lard. 90% of the items we use are made fresh in-house.
